Gabrielė Valodskaitė is the Wider Europe programme assistant based in the Berlin office of the European Council on Foreign Relations.
Prior to joining ECFR, she was a research assistant at Vrije Universiteit Brussel, working on projects examining the EU’s asylum and migration policy. She was also a Schuman trainee at the Directorate-General for Communication at the European Parliament. Before that, she was a communications intern at ECFR.
Valodskaite holds an MSc in European and international governance from Vrije Universiteit Brussel and a BA in European studies from Maastricht University.
Her research interests include EU external relations, as well as migration and asylum policies.
